Well, a good buddy of mine who served got me hooked on AR's recently.  I started this build in April and just finished her today.  My goal was to put together a quality rifle at a respectable price.  She's made up of the following components.

PSA lower with Magpul MOE furniture.
PSA CHF 16" Mid-Length Upper
Magpul B.A.D. lever (still deciding on whether or not I will keep it)
Daniel Defense Omega 9.0 rail
Aimpoint Pro
Magpul Pro BUIS
Grip Stop
Surefire Scout m600u with Larue QD mount
Blue Force Gear VCAS

This was my first time painting a gun of any kind and I like how she turned out.  I combined the mesh bag and straw method and used the following Aervoe colors:  Sand, Forest Green, Olive Drab, and Field Drab.  Since the original ladder style rail covers were rubber, I opted for the Larue rail clips so that the paint would adhere better.  This rifle is now 100%, now to move on to the next one.
